Reproof
see synonyms of reproofNoun
1. rebuke, reprehension, reprimand, reproof, reproval
an act or expression of criticism and censure
Example Sentences:'he had to take the rebuke with a smile on his face'
Verb
2. bawl out, berate, call down, call on the carpet, chew out, chew up, chide, dress down, have words, jaw, lambast, lambaste, lecture, rag, rebuke, remonstrate, reprimand, reproof, scold, take to task, trounce
censure severely or angrily
Example Sentences:'The mother scolded the child for entering a stranger's car''The deputy ragged the Prime Minister''The customer dressed down the waiter for bringing cold soup'
